Product reviews:
Nelson
2025-01-06 iphone 11 Pro Max
sawgrass mills mall nike factory store sawgrass mills nike store
sawgrass mills nike store
MIAMI FLORIDA ESTADOS UNIDOS sawgrass mills nike store
sawgrass mills nike store
Sidney
2025-01-03 iphone 7 Plus
sawgrass mills - South Florida Sun-Sentinel sawgrass mills nike store
sawgrass mills nike store
Do Business at Sawgrass Mills®, a Simon sawgrass mills nike store
sawgrass mills nike store